February 14, 1995 <br /> <br /> At a Called Meeting of the City Council on Tuesday, <br />February 14, 1995, there were present: <br /> <br /> *Mayor Gloria O. Webb~ Vice Mayor Johnny M. Clemons, <br />Bernard D. Griffin, Sr., James C. Hawks, *James T. Martin, <br />Cameron C. Pitts, *P. Ward Robinett, Jr., V. Wayne Orton, City <br />Manager, Stuart E. Katz, City Attorney. <br /> <br />95-65 The following call for the meeting was read: <br /> <br /> "Please attend a Called Meeting of the City Council to be <br />held in the City Council Chamber, 6th floor of City Hall, 801 <br />Crawford Street, at 5:00 p.m., Tuesday, February 14, 1995, for <br />the purpose of a Public Work Session. <br /> <br /> In addition, you may consider a motion to go into an <br />Executive Session. <br /> <br />By order of the Mayor." <br /> <br /> 95-66 - The following items were discussed in the Public <br />Work Session: <br /> <br />1. Update on 5825 Branch Street <br />2. Update on Galaxy Project <br />3. Medical services by Maryview <br /> <br /> Motion by Mr. Pitts, and seconded by Mr. Griffin, to go <br />into Executive Session pursuant to provisions of Section <br />2.1-344 of the Code of Virginia for the following: <br /> <br /> (1) Consideration of appointments to Boards and <br />Commissions by the City Council, as permitted under Subsection <br />(A) (1); <br /> <br /> (2) Discussion or consideration of the use of real <br />property for public purpose or the disposition of publicly <br />held rea~ property in the PortCentre, downtown and central <br />portions of the City, as permitted under Subsection (A) (3); <br /> <br /> (3) Consultation with the City Attorney and briefing by <br />staff regarding legal matters involving SPSA, and the Adelman <br />suit, as permitted under Subsection (A) (7). <br /> <br />The motion was adopted by unanimous vote. <br /> <br /> Motion of Mr. Clemons, and seconded by Mr. Robinett, <br />pursuant to Section 2.1-344.1 of the Code of Virginia <br />certifying that to the best of the Council member's knowledge <br />during the immediately preceding Executive Session of the City <br />Council: <br /> <br /> (1) Only public business matters lawfully exempted from <br />open meeting requirements by the Virginia Freedom of <br />Information Act, and <br /> <br /> (2) Only such public business matters as were identified <br />in the motion by which the Executive Session was convened, were <br />heard, discussed or considered in the meeting by the City <br />Council. <br /> <br /> The motion was adopted by unanimous vote. <br /> <br /> <br />
